Computers have completely revolutionized the way we live
and work. In the process, the computer industry has become one of the hottest,
fastest-growing industries the world over. So there are job opportunities
aplenty. But there are pitfalls, too; for instance, rapidly changing technology
renders knowledge and skills obsolete.
This book shows how you can side-step the traps and focus
on taking advantage of the exciting career opportunities the world of computers
offers you:

Rakesh Narang
Rakesh Narang has been involved with computers for over ten years now. With a Bachelor’s degree in Engineering and a Master’s in Business Administration, Rakesh has worked with India’s leading information technology organisations and has been instrumental in introducing for the first time many new products in the Indian markets. He advanced his skills in networking and communications working with the Indian subsidiary of Digital Equipment Corporation. Later he joined HCL Hewlett-Packard Limited, India’s largest information technology company, and played a leading role in introducing world-class products in India.
Author of the best selling book,
NetWare: Tips, Tricks & Techniques, he has also written the popular Networking for Nitwits series for a leading computer journal in India. His helpline article, On-Line Networking published in
Dataquest was the first ever article in India to provide practical solutions in networking and telecommunications. His cover story How to Build Your Own LAN in less than an Hour in
Computers & Communications magazine was a collector's issue. Presently he heads the CONNECT operations in India offering consultancy in various fields and is also the Technical Editor for
PC World.
